Latest Patents

Nicholas W Neuberg holds a patent for a method of providing friable polytetrafluoroethylene products. This method involves handling the PTFE starting material at a temperature below 66°F, and preferably below 55°F, before irradiating it. The process ensures that the resulting PTFE product has particles of a desired size that are flowable and do not tend to agglomerate. Additionally, mixing the PTFE with a wetting agent before irradiation enhances the product's dispersibility. The radiation source used in this method may include electron beam radiation, nuclear radiation, or radiation from a cobalt-60 source. He has 1 patent to his name.

Career Highlights

Nicholas W Neuberg is associated with Shamrock Chemicals Corporation, where he applies his expertise in materials science.
